pbAn expansive, exhilarating work of criticism by one of the most significant writers of our dayb pSo often deployed as a jingoistic, even menacing rallying cry, or limited by a focus on passing moments of liberation, the rhetoric of freedom both rouses and repels. Does it remain key to our autonomy, justice, and well-being, or is freedom's long star turn coming to a close Does a continued obsession with the term enliven and emancipate, or reflect a deepening nihilism or both iOn Freedomi examines such questions by tracing the concept's complexities in four distinct realms art, sex, drugs, and climate. pDrawing on a vast range of material, from critical theory to pop culture to the intimacies and plain exchanges of daily life, Maggie Nelson explores how we might think, experience, or talk about freedom in ways responsive to the conditions of our day.
